The Expertise Tax: Moving From Hero to Host Leader
from The Hidden Load: For the educators and leaders in medicine who hold everyone up. · host Dr. Santina Wheat
When you first clip on your ID badge, it feels like a suit of armor—proof that you belong in the room and have all the answers. But as you move into healthcare leadership or medical education, that armor can become a barrier. In this solo episode, Dr. Santina Wheat breaks down the Expertise Tax: the immense, crushing pressure to be the all-knowing expert at all times.Sharing a vulnerable chapter from her own career, Dr. Wheat exposes the trap of trying to "outperform your insecurity," which inevitably leads to micromanagement and team suffocation. Tune in to discover practical strategies to shift your identity from a "hero leader" to a "host leader," reclaim your time, and build a sustainable leadership pathway for the next generation.Key Takeaways for Leaders and Educators:The Expertise Tax: The hidden cost of trying to prove your worth through your credentials, which turns leaders into structural bottlenecks.The Perfectionism Shield: Why perfectionism in medical leadership isn't excellence—it is simply a high-end version of fear rooted in medicine's shame-based culture.The "I Don’t Know" Power Move: Why admitting you don't have the answer isn't a sign of weakness, but a deliberate way to create space for your team’s brilliance.Relinquishing the "How": Learning to define the what and the why of a project while letting go of the how, accepting that the 20% gap in perfection is the price of your team's growth and your freedom.The Shadow You Cast: How "white-knuckling" your leadership role inadvertently discourages your trainees from pursuing leadership and education paths.Your Monday Morning Challenges:Challenge 1: Take your ID badge off for five minutes before your next meeting.
